Output eca1c0c00d736ca169fde7f0cf262e155f0e11bc29acb7bf6aaef1243f9a2fac:0

value
178588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51504335bfc731b767b2ec130da624a7186485d8 OP_EQUAL
address
396xopa46pEUG2C2e8G8JGomGrje41qEZa
transaction
eca1c0c00d736ca169fde7f0cf262e155f0e11bc29acb7bf6aaef1243f9a2fac
confirmations
393754
spent
true